Marketing Assistant - Shewmake Plastic Surgery

Posted December 09, 2025
Hourly, full-time

Job Overview

Work Schedule:

  • This is a Full-Time position
  • Monday - Thursday 8:30 AM - 5:00 PM, Friday 8:30 AM - 1:30 PM

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with management and CPP corporate marketing to create properly branded copy, videos, photos, and other assets for the website, social media, monthly newsletter, in-office events, B2B collaborations, training materials, and other marketing initiatives.
  • Prepare final designs for handoff to developers or printers, ensuring all files are properly formatted, organized, and meet project requirements.
  • Assist with photo shoots and video production as needed, providing input on shot selection, styling, and set design to align with the brand's vision.
  • Continuously improve design skills through research, practice, and constructive feedback.
  • Contribute to the business's growth by enhancing customer engagement and loyalty across all platforms.
  • Develop fresh, engaging digital assets that promote brand consistency and ensure clarity across all marketing channels.
  • Collaborate with influencers to develop and prepare content for social media campaigns.
  • Gather patient and market insights to inform outreach strategies, improve patient conversion rates, and generate more qualified leads.
  • Track, analyze, and optimize the effectiveness and impact of current marketing initiatives.
  • Proactively build and maintain strong relationships with B2B clients, partners, and industry contacts to drive lead generation and business growth.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Graphic Design, Fine Art, Marketing,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in graphic design, marketing, or fine art.
  • Proven proficiency with design tools such as Adobe Creative Suite or Canva, as well as marketing platforms like Constant Contact, ClickSend, and Zenoti.
  • Excellent listening, written, verbal, and proofreading communication skills.
  • Demonstrated experience in developing and executing marketing plans and campaigns.
  • Strong project management skills, with the ability to multitask and make informed decisions under tight deadlines.
  • Deep understanding of market data, trends, patient attitudes and behaviors, and the competitive landscape to identify and capitalize on current and future opportunities.
  • Metrics-driven mindset with a creative approach to marketing.
  • Experience with marketing automation and other digital tools to optimize campaigns and engagement.

Compensation:

  • Up to $25/hr. depending on experience.
